Abstract
A transport cylinder (1) suitable for a multicolour sheet feed printing machine comprises a rigid core (2) covered on the exterior thereof with a flexible sheet material (3). The material (3) provides a plurality of radially outwardly extending stiff filamentary protrusions (4). The transport cylinder reduces the extent to which printed matter is contaminated with spurious ink marks as a result of contamination of the transfer cylinder with ink. The sheet (3) and protrusions (4) may be constituted by either part of a "hook and loop" type fastening. <IMAGE>
Description
TRANSPORT CYLINDER FOR PRINTING MACHINE
This invention relates to a transport cylinder for a printing machine, that is to say a cylinder which is used in a printing machine to assist in the transport of matter being printed through the machine. The transport cylinder may be driven or may idle, and may contact the obverse or reverse side of matter being printed. A particularly preferred embodiment of the invention relates to a transfer cylinder for use in a printing machine.
In rotary printing machines the matter to be printed is transported through the machine via one or more transport cylinders. Such transport cylinders are liable to be contaminated with printing ink, and if this occurs such ink is liable to contaminate the matter being printed.
This can lead to quality control rejection of the printed matter. The problem is particularly acute in the case of multi-colour sheet fed printing machines in which transfer cylinders are used to contact the printed face of matter being printed between each printing stage. If any one of these transfer cylinders becomes contaminated with ink, the matter printed is liable to be marked in an unacceptable manner. In the prior art, such transfer cylinders have been treated with a silicon material with a view to reducing the risk of ink contamination, but such treatment is not wholly satisfactory.
According to one aspect of the present invention a transport cylinder for a printing machine comprises a body and a multiplicity of stiff filamentary protrusions extending from the body whereby the surface of the cylinder which is contacted by matter to be printed is formed by the radially outermost portions of the protrusions.
Although the invention is a particular application to the transfer cylinders of a colour printing machine, the invention is of potential use in relation to all cylinders used for the transport of material through a printing machine.
In a particularly preferred embodiment of the invention the transport cylinder comprises a rigid core having a surface to which a flexible sheet material is releasably secured to provide the desired protrusions. The flexible sheet material can advantageously be adhesively secured to the core and can readily be removed and changed when the material becomes worn or unacceptably contaminated with ink. The flexible sheet material can advantageously be in the form of a flexible web having extended from one surface thereof the filamentary protrusions. For example, the flexible sheet material may be the male component of "touch and close" fastener material. In preferred embodiments of the invention, the male component of touch and close material is of polypropylene, and the filamentary protrusions terminate in mushroom heads or hook ends.

Referring firstly to Figure 1, there is shown a schematic cross-sectional view of a transfer cylinder 1 for use in a multi-colour sheet fed printing machine. The transfer cylinder 1 comprises a rigid core 2 covered on the exterior surface thereof with a flexible sheet material 3.
The flexible sheet material may be secured to the core by any suitable means, and in the preferred embodiment of the invention the flexible sheet material is coated on one surface with a pressure sensitive adhesive so that it may readily be adhesively secured to the core 2, and stripped from the core 2 for replacement.
The material 3 provides a plurality of radially outwardly extending stiff filamentary protrusions 4 whereby the surface of the transfer cylinder which contacts matter to be printed is formed by the radially outermost ends of the protrusions. The protrusions are short, numerous and closely spaced. For example protrusions having a length of 0.6 mm and a density of 77 protrusions per square centimeter has been found to be satisfactory. The protrusions are sufficiently stiff to resist crushing by items to be printed in use of the machine.
Referring to Figures 2 and 3, two practical embodiments of the invention are illustrated in greater detail. In the embodiment of Figure 2, the flexible sheet material comprises a base layer 5 having the filamentary protrusions 4 extending therefrom. The free end of each filamentary protrusion is enlarged relative to the shaft of the filamentary protrusion to provide each filamentary protrusion with a generally "mushroom" shape.
Referring now to Figure 3, the flexible sheet material comprises a base layer 5A from which the protrusions 4 extend. At least some of the protrusions have hook-like ends.
The flexible sheet materials may conveniently be one of the members of known touch and close systems.
It has been found that use of the transfer cylinder described above significantly reduces the extent to which printed matter is contaminated with spurious ink marks as a result of contamination of the transfer cylinder with ink. As a result, the problem of quality control rejection of printed material because of spurious ink marks is greatly reduced. Further, it has been found that the proposed transfer cylinder improves sheet handling within printing machines by reduction of friction in the transfer process. This reduction in friction relieves the printed material of stresses to which it would otherwise be subject, and thereby improves the register of the matter to be printed in the various stages of colour printing.
Whilst, as indicated above, the invention may be practiced using the male component of touch and close fastening materials, it is believed that the invention may be practiced using other suitable flexible sheet materials having appropriate protrusions, including the female component of touch and close fastening materials.
